Navigating to the Hunting Territory
The journey begins by traveling northwest from the town of Strawberry into the rugged forests of Big Valley. Your target roams a densely wooded region located just north of Owanjila Lake, near the western edge of the map border. It is essential to approach this territory quietly to avoid startling nearby wildlife before the tracking process officially starts.
Upon entering the area, a prompt will appear on your screen indicating that you have crossed into the domain of a rare creature. If the game warns you of high activity in the area, set up a temporary camp nearby and sleep until the next morning. This simple tactic resets the local environment and ensures the animal spawns properly without interference from random events.
Locating the Environmental Clues
To begin the tracking sequence, activate your tracking vision to scan the environment for highlighted golden dust particles. The first clue is typically situated near a cluster of withered, dead trees on a small ridge. Examining this initial spot reveals broken twigs and dung left behind by the massive herbivore.
Following the glowing path leads you deeper into the timberline toward two subsequent investigation points. The second clue usually consists of rubbed bark on a nearby tree trunk, indicating the animal passed through recently. The final clue will point directly toward the dense brush where the creature is currently grazing peacefully.
Securing the Clean Harvest
Once the tracking meter fills completely, move forward cautiously while crouched to keep your presence hidden from the buck. Since legendary animal pelts cannot be damaged by multiple shots, using high-powered firearms like a Rolling Block Rifle is highly recommended. Aim directly for the head or heart area to drop the target instantly before it gets a chance to flee into the thick woods.
After successfully taking down the white-furred deer, harvest the rare components from the carcass immediately. You should stow the heavy pelt securely on the back of your horse before heading toward the nearest trading post. Crafting the Legendary Upgrades
Your final destination is the nearest fence location to convert the harvested antlers into a unique passive accessory. The resulting trinket permanently increases the quality of all pelts obtained during regular hunting trips throughout the world. This upgrade makes completing future crafting projects for your camp significantly faster and much more satisfying.
